【摘要】 介绍了应用高温空气燃烧技术研制开发W型和U型蓄热式燃气辐射管燃烧器的工作原理、技术特点和性能指标。研究指出,蓄热式燃气辐射管燃烧器是一种高效、节能、低污染的工业炉用加热装置。可广泛应用于机械、冶金、石化、电子、兵器、轻工、电器、交通、建材、纺织、汽车、航空航天和食品工业等加热炉设备上,具有广阔的应用前景。
